Blog Managers are responsible for the planning, creation, and management of written content for blogs, websites, and other online platforms. They develop and implement content strategies, oversee the creation of blog posts, articles, and other written materials, and manage the day-to-day operations of a blog or website. Blog Managers work closely with other marketing and communications professionals to ensure that content is aligned with the overall marketing and business goals of the organization.

Responsibilities

The responsibilities of a Blog Manager can vary depending on the size and scope of the organization, but some common responsibilities include:

  • Developing and implementing content strategies for blogs and websites
  • Overseeing the creation of blog posts, articles, and other written materials
  • Managing the day-to-day operations of a blog or website
  • Working closely with other marketing and communications professionals to ensure that content is aligned with the overall marketing and business goals of the organization

Qualifications

Blog Managers typically have a bachelor's degree in marketing, communications, journalism, or a related field. They also have several years of experience in content creation and management. Blog Managers should be able to write clearly and concisely, and have a strong understanding of SEO and social media marketing. They should also be able to work independently and as part of a team.
